summaryrefslogtreecommitdiff
path: root/regcomp.c
Commit message (Expand)AuthorAgeFilesLines
* regcomp.c: Use less peak memoryKarl Williamson2016-02-271-67/+102
* regcomp.c: Modify an assertKarl Williamson2016-02-271-1/+1
* regcomp.c: Avoid an unnecessary mortal SVKarl Williamson2016-02-271-1/+6
* regcomp.c: Improve free-ing up unused inversion list spaceKarl Williamson2016-02-271-6/+12
* regcomp.c: Add new static inline convenience functionKarl Williamson2016-02-271-2/+12
* regcomp.c: Change variable names, white-spaceKarl Williamson2016-02-271-21/+30
* regcomp.c: Change name of static functionKarl Williamson2016-02-271-4/+4
* regcomp.c: Add missing 'STATIC'Karl Williamson2016-02-261-1/+1
* Fix regex failures on big-endian systemsKarl Williamson2016-02-261-1/+2
* Use less memory in compiling regexesKarl Williamson2016-02-231-27/+97
* regcomp.c: Guard against corrupting inversion list SVKarl Williamson2016-02-231-3/+6
* Add assert(matches_string).Jarkko Hietaniemi2016-02-201-0/+1
* Cast PL_dump_re_max_len to avoid type mismatch warning.Craig A. Berry2016-02-191-1/+1
* regcomp.c: White-space onlyKarl Williamson2016-02-191-40/+43
* regcomp.c: Can't do optimization if invertingKarl Williamson2016-02-191-0/+3
* regcomp.c: Use colors for -Dr metanotationKarl Williamson2016-02-191-4/+3
* regcomp.c: Backlslash {} in -Dr outputKarl Williamson2016-02-191-1/+4
* Revamp -Dr handling of /[...]/Karl Williamson2016-02-191-205/+552
* Add environment variable for -Dr: PERL_DUMP_RE_MAX_LENKarl Williamson2016-02-191-1/+16
* regcomp.c: Save a branch testKarl Williamson2016-02-191-2/+2
* regcomp.c: Clarify -Dr output under /lKarl Williamson2016-02-191-3/+1
* regcomp.c: Comments, white-space, add grouping () for clarityKarl Williamson2016-02-191-26/+38
* Add a parameter to a static functionKarl Williamson2016-02-191-10/+30
* Change private function to staticKarl Williamson2016-02-191-8/+6
* regcomp.c: Change structure element size and locKarl Williamson2016-02-191-1/+1
* regcomp.c: Move static declaration to file levelKarl Williamson2016-02-181-43/+47
* regcomp.c: optimization for qr/[...]/ilKarl Williamson2016-02-181-0/+13
* regcomp.c: Avoid a segfaultKarl Williamson2016-02-181-2/+4
* PATCH: [perl 127537] /\W/ regression with UTF-8Karl Williamson2016-02-181-2/+4
* Cast correctly to U8, not charKarl Williamson2016-02-181-1/+1
* regcomp.c: Simplify a few lines of codeKarl Williamson2016-02-181-7/+4
* regcomp.c: Clean up logic in functionKarl Williamson2016-02-181-18/+11
* regcomp.c: -Dr \xZZ instead of \x{ZZ}Karl Williamson2016-02-181-3/+3
* regcomp.c: Fix -Dr bugKarl Williamson2016-02-181-5/+13
* regcomp.c: Use macro to hide complexityKarl Williamson2016-02-181-3/+1
* Don't allow /\N{}/ under 're strict'Karl Williamson2016-02-181-5/+9
* regcomp.c: Clarify error messageKarl Williamson2016-02-101-1/+1
* regcomp.c: Replace invalid assertionKarl Williamson2016-02-101-1/+4
* regcomp.c: Avoid a function call in a common caseKarl Williamson2016-02-101-1/+1
* regcomp.c: Add some grouping parensKarl Williamson2016-02-101-2/+2
* regcomp.c, regexec.c: Comments, white-space onlyKarl Williamson2016-02-101-34/+35
* regcomp.c: Fix some parsing glitchesKarl Williamson2016-02-101-51/+91
* regcomp.c: Extract duped code into one fcnKarl Williamson2016-02-101-71/+60
* PATCH: [perl #8904] Revamp [:posix:] parsingKarl Williamson2016-02-091-153/+841
* regcomp.c: Fix recursive parsing bugKarl Williamson2016-02-091-1/+6
* regcomp.c: White-space, variable name-change onlyKarl Williamson2016-02-091-70/+69
* regcomp.c: Add code to compute edit distance (Damerau–Levenshtein)Karl Williamson2016-02-091-0/+145
* Assert no bad array access.Jarkko Hietaniemi2016-02-071-0/+1
* Add qr/\b{lb}/Karl Williamson2016-01-191-0/+7
* regcomp.c: Add comment.Karl Williamson2015-12-261-0/+3